Did you know ?
One intriguing aspect of Skipton's history lies with the Skipton Castle, one of the best-preserved medieval castles in England. Built in 1090 by Robert de Romille, a Norman baron, this castle has stood the test of time and witnessed many historical events. During the English Civil War, it was under siege for three years by Oliver Cromwell's troops but never surrendered. The castle's resilience throughout history is a testament to its sturdy design and strategic position. Today, the Skipton Castle is open to the public, offering a glimpse into the medieval era and the town's rich past.

Located in the heart of the quaint county of North Yorkshire, England, the charming town of Skipton is steeped in rich history and graced with remarkable geographical features. Known as the 'Gateway to the Dales', Skipton is a picturesque locale that effortlessly combines the allure of its medieval past with the vibrancy of the present, making it a true jewel in North Yorkshire's crown.
The historical significance of Skipton is evident in its awe-inspiring landmarks, such as the remarkable Skipton Castle. This 900-year-old fortress stands as a testament to Skipton's enduring resilience and offers visitors a unique glimpse into the region's fascinating past. Moreover, the town's traditional market, operating since medieval times, is a dynamic hub that showcases Skipton's thriving local commerce and community spirit.
Skipton's geographical features are just as impressive as its historical landmarks. The town is nestled amidst the stunning landscapes of the Yorkshire Dales, offering breathtaking views of rolling hills, verdant pastures, and serene waterways. The Leeds and Liverpool Canal, in particular, presents a tranquil waterway that meanders through the town, providing a scenic backdrop for leisurely strolls and boat rides.

Fun Fact !
Skipton is also known as the 'Gateway to the Dales' due to its geographical location on the outskirts of the Yorkshire Dales National Park. This strategic location has played a significant role in the town's cultural and economic development. The surrounding countryside, with its picturesque dales and moorland, offers a wealth of outdoor activities which attracts many visitors each year. Additionally, the Leeds and Liverpool Canal, which passes through the town, was once a vital transport route during the Industrial Revolution, boosting Skipton's economy. Today, the canal offers leisure pursuits such as boating and picturesque walks, further enhancing Skipton's appeal as a cultural and tourist hub.
Wikipedia Says
Skipton (also known as Skipton-in-Craven) is a market town and civil parish in North Yorkshire, England. Historically in the East Division of Staincliffe Wapentake in the West Riding of Yorkshire, it is on the River Aire and the Leeds and Liverpool Canal to the south of the Yorkshire Dales. It is situated 27 miles (43 km) north-west of Leeds and 38 miles (61 km) west of York. At the 2021 Census, the population was 14,623. The town has been listed as one of the best and happiest places to live in the UK.
